In the meeting held on May 19, 2025, the State Council of Quality, which operates under the Kosovo Accreditation Agency, reaccredited and accredited several study programs across the faculties of the University of Prishtina (UP). To the already extensive list of accredited programs at UP, which offers various career-oriented opportunities for recent high school graduates, the State Council of Quality decided to add seven more study programs ⭐ across five faculties just eight days ago.

As a result, the University of Prishtina currently offers students 63 programs at the bachelor level, 70 at the master level, and seven at the doctoral level, bringing the total to 140 study programs across all three academic levels.

For the first time, the master’s program in Energy and Energy Management ⚡ from the Faculty of Electrical and Computer Engineering has been accredited after a nine-year wait.

Along with the accreditation of this program in energy, a highly important sector for the country, the State Council of Quality, in its meeting held on May 19, 2025, also reaccredited the following programs:

  • Veterinary Medicine (🐄) (DMV level) — Faculty of Agriculture and Veterinary Medicine
  • Viticulture and Horticulture (🍇) (master level) — Faculty of Agriculture and Veterinary Medicine
  • Plant Production (🌱) (bachelor level) — Faculty of Agriculture and Veterinary Medicine
  • Electrical Energy (⚡) (bachelor level) — Faculty of Electrical and Computer Engineering
  • Pharmacy (💊) (MPH level) — Faculty of Medicine
  • Biology (🔬) (master level) — Faculty of Mathematical and Natural Sciences

The University of Prishtina, the oldest, largest, and most successful higher education institution in Kosovo 🏆 and ranked the highest among all universities in the Albanian-speaking regions of the Balkans on international platforms, successfully completed its institutional reaccreditation process in December 2024. This university is accredited until 2030.
